Stop Flying
Planes produce the most carbon emissions out of any vehicle. On average, they emit 1/4 tonne CO2 equivalent per hour of flying. https://www.carbonindependent.org/22.html Goal: - Stop flying domestically. Take trains or buses. - Only fly internationally when absolutely unavoidable.

Stop Driving Gas Cars
Gasoline-powered cars emit from 8-15 kg CO2 per gallon of fuel. https://www.epa.gov/greenvehicles/greenhouse-gas-emissions-typical-passenger-vehicle#:~:text=typical%20passenger%20vehicle%3F-,A%20typical%20passenger%20vehicle%20emits%20about%204.6%20metric%20tons%20of,8%2C887%20grams%20of%20CO2. Buying gasoline, which is produced from oil, funds the massive oil companies, who continue to drill for more oil - destroying environments and emitting ever more GHGs. Challenge: Everyone stop driving gas cars. Use public transportation (if in Seattle, it has one of the nation's best systems!), drive an electric vehicle, bike or walk.

Become Fully Vegan
Animal agriculture contributes 15%+ of GHGs and devastates environments all over the world (ex. the Amazon is being cleared for cattle ranches & growing cow feed). I will go fully vegan so I am no longer contributing to the destruction of the planet. This includes food, products, cosmetics, soaps, clothing, furniture, medication etc. I will review what ingredients are derived from animals and avoid these in all products: https://www.peta.org/living/food/animal-ingredients-list/

REFLECTION QUESTIONBasic Needs & SecurityWhat watershed do you live in presently? What is something interesting or unique about your watershed?
Avery Huberts 4/04/2022 8:23 AMSeattle is in the Cedar River and Tolt River watersheds. The Cedar River originates in the Cascade Range. About two-thirds of King County uses water from the Cedar River Watershed, which provides drinking water for 1.4 million people in the greater Seattle area. -
